Output d69495cc3f3e204a0fbefc7544a90dd4788c8b8f3941a8acfb0d680c0a2a153a:1

value
5152997
script pubkey
OP_0 OP_PUSHBYTES_20 3b27de4182ab4cd658d4b1347296649eeb357833
address
bc1q8vnausvz4dxdvkx5ky6899nynm4n27pnvqjxmq
transaction
d69495cc3f3e204a0fbefc7544a90dd4788c8b8f3941a8acfb0d680c0a2a153a
confirmations
106609
spent
true